I found this recipe for cat treats - not sure they are all that healthy, but if you treated them sparingly perhaps they might be good:

INGREDIENTS:
1 cup whole wheat flour
1/4 cup soy flour
1 teaspoon Catnip
1 Egg
1/3 cup milk
2 Tablespoon wheat germ
1/3 cup powdered milk
1 Tablespoon unsulphured molasses
2 Tablespoons butter or vegetable oil

DIRECTIONS:
Preheat oven to 350 degrees F. Mix dry ingredients together. Add
molasses, egg, oil and milk. Roll out flat onto oiled cookie sheet and cut into small, cat bite-sized pieces.
Bake for 20 minutes. Let cool and store in tightly sealed container.
